Webb14 okt. 2024 · In general, it costs between $80 and $120 per square metre to have a tiled roof installed. $80m2 is a fairly simple single storey roof. It could cost more than $120m2 for a complex roof with a steep pitch. As a rule, installers charge around $2 to $5 more for every 5 degrees the pitch increases over 35 degrees. WebbIn a nutshell, the roof’s slope factor = √ (rise 2 + run 2) ÷ run. The slope factor is then used to determine the area of a roof section. This is done by multiplying the raw roof area (length by width) with the slope factor value. Repeat this for each section of the roof. Roof Square Footage pack foam insulation https://frmgov.org

How To Determine How Many Squares A Roof Is

Webb26 juni 2024 · Add the square footage for each roof plane into one total. 1,260 sq. ft. + 1,260 sq. ft. = 2,520 sq. ft. Divide to find the squares. To find how many squares are on your roof, divide the total square footage of all your planes by 100. In our example, the total was 25.2 squares 2,520 sq. ft. divided by 100.
